You’ll want to look for models with wide, reinforced bases and extra-large platforms—something that won’t tip over when your cat makes a running leap. Materials matter, too: thick, natural sisal for scratching, plush fabrics for lounging, and solid wood or reinforced posts for stability. If your cat’s a bit older or has mobility issues, consider options with ramps or lower entry points so they can still enjoy the view without having to jump too high.
